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Multimedia (https://www.delphipraxis.net/16-multimedia/)
-   -   Delphi Probleme mit DirectX VideoRenderer.... (https://www.delphipraxis.net/80978-probleme-mit-directx-videorenderer.html)

bingo72 18. Nov 2006 13:13


Probleme mit DirectX VideoRenderer....
 
Hallo Experten!!

Seit ein paar Tagen quält mich ein komisches Phänomen:
Ich zeige 2 LiveStreams in meiner Application an --> je eine separate Webcam (Typhoon Easycam 1.3) zeigt ihren Stream in einem VideoWindow an. Jeder Stream wird in eimem eigenen Filtergraphen ausgeführt:

Video Capture Source --> SmartTee (PreviewPin) --> Video Mixing Renderer9

Dies funktioniert auch recht gut, solange die Webcams genug Tageslicht bekommen, obwohl das Büro ausreichend mit Neonröhren ausgeleutet ist. Wenn das Tageslicht abnimmt crashed die ganze Sache dermassen böse, daß ich ohne Fehlermeldung einen Blackscreen bekomme und der PC neu bootet.
Wechsle ich den VideoRenderer9 gegen einen anderen VideoRenderer bekomme ich beide Streams schnell oszilierend in nur einem der beiden VideoWindows.
Ich lasse zur Sicherheit bei der Ausführung meiner Applikation immer noch den GraphEdit-File erstellen, damit ich die Verbindungen der Filter checken kann....alles ok. Ausserdem check ich jeden HResult auf Fehler. Wenn da was schief laufen würde, bekomm ich eine Fehlermeldung!! Auch kann ich dort die VideoWindows ohne Probleme darstellen....auch bei weniger Tageslicht und/oder ausgewechselten VideoRenderer!!
Ebenfalls ohne Probleme laufen die Webcams in der emAMCap-Applikation....

Der Nachbar-PC hat weder mit dem Tageslicht noch mit dem Austausch der VideoRenderer ein Problem. Beide Geräte sind HP-XP-Rechner mit über 3 GHZ.

Da es sich um eine komerzielle Software handelt, muß ich natürlich den Grund dafür herausfinden...!!
Kennt jemand so einen Fall?? :gruebel:

LG
Thomas

bingo72 20. Nov 2006 07:20

Re: Probleme mit DirectX VideoRenderer....
 
Nun hab ich auch festgestellt, daß auch der Nachbar-PC bei zuwenig Licht abstürzt...

Hat keiner eine Idee??

LG
Thomas

bingo72 20. Nov 2006 17:44

Re: Probleme mit DirectX VideoRenderer....
 
Problem gelöst....bei diesen Cameras gibt es unter Capture-Settings einen Punkt 'Dark Area'....die Checkbox nicht anklicken und dann gehts....bei mir zumindest...


Alle Zeitangaben in WEZ +1. Es ist jetzt 06:39 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z